Residing in Calgary since birth, Mary Annan (she/her) navigates her daily life as a working class black woman, new to academia.
With a primary focus on photography, as well as writing, she uses these medias to explore and capture an array of perspectives and emotions.
She hopes to encourage reflection and truth through her current and future works.

Devin Kotani is a mixed-race theatre artist based in Mohkinstsis/Calgary. He has worked as an actor and director since receiving is Bachelor of Fine Arts from the University of Calgary.
